Output 2eb7453cfbd71994801909c82f2edcfca7e2236d430c19bedaac0ca210415ec3:1

value
2725825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e4787d2dd15f3e834c057f0f4c9aaef5ce7361 OP_EQUAL
address
3MTqaQ66itS7fYPn1A3apJH1e7ykzf8J8a
transaction
2eb7453cfbd71994801909c82f2edcfca7e2236d430c19bedaac0ca210415ec3
confirmations
180146
spent
true